Background
Ochmanek, David Alan was born on April 10, 1951 in Oak Park, Illinois, United States. Son of Edwin Joseph and Phyllis Jean Ochmanek.

(Deterrence of nuclear use through the threat of retaliati...)
Deterrence of nuclear use through the threat of retaliation could be highly problematic in many plausible conflict scenarios with nucleararmed regional adversaries. This could compel U.S. leaders to temper their military and political objectives if they come into conflict with these states. This book examines the reasons behind this important shift in the international security environment and its strategic and force planning implications.

Bachelor of Science in International Affairs, Political Science, United States Air Force Academy, 1973. Master of Public Administration in Public Affairs and International Relations, Princeton University, 1980.
Foreign service officer United States Department State, 1980-1985. Professional staff The Research and Development Corporation, Washington, 1985—1993, senior defense analyst, 1995—2009. Deputy assistant secretary for strategy United States Department Defense, 1993-1995, deputy assistant secretary for force development, since 2009.

Captain United States Air Force, 1973-1978.
Married Barbara Jane Larson, June 16, 1973. Children: James Edwin, Anne Skaaden.
